POSCO Holdings begins construction of $830M lithium plant in Argentina

Green Car Congress

Korea-based POSCO Holdings recently started construction of a lithium commercialization plant in Argentina. POSCO Group is the first to produce lithium hydroxide for batteries in Argentina throughout the entire process from the acquisition of mining rights to exploration, construction and operation of a production plant. POSCO to invest $830M in lithium hydroxide plant in Argentina

Green Car Congress

South Korea-based steelmaker POSCO will invest US$830 million in a lithium hydroxide plant in Argentina. Earlier in 2021 year, POSCO broke ground on a lithium hydroxide plant in South Korea with an annual production capacity of 43,000 tons of lithium hydroxide—enough to manufacture about 1 million electric vehicles, according to POSCO.

Bass Metals to acquire San Jorge lithium brine project in Argentina

Green Car Congress

Australia-based Bass Metals has signed a binding term sheet to acquire Blackearth SA which holds an option to acquire the san Jorge Lithium Project located in Catamarca province, Argentina.
